Vornborrtjärnen
Character of the water
Vornborrtjärnen lies in the cold north — a northern nutrient-rich lowland lake. In summer a thermocline settles around 5 m and splits the lake into two worlds.
The surroundings
The lake lies half-remote, a fair way from the nearest road, tucked into woodland.
Moderately deep (10 m) — shallow bays, the odd reef and a deeper channel through the middle.
Permits & rules
Fishing permit required — Vornborrtjärnen FVOF. Day permit ~140 kr · annual permit ~700 kr.
- Pike: keep at most one over 75 cm per day.
- Handheld tackle only. Respect the protected zones at the inlets and outlets.

General rules of thumb for this kind of water
- Stratified, oxygen-poor lakes push the fish up above the thermocline in summer.
- Nutrient-rich lakes hold plenty of baitfish but often murky water.
